+/* Copyright (c) 1997-1998 by Juliusz Chroboczek */
+
+
+typedef unsigned char BYTE;
+typedef signed char CHAR;
+typedef unsigned short USHORT;
+typedef short SHORT;
+typedef unsigned long ULONG;
+typedef long LONG;
+
+/* Endianness conversions */
+#ifdef SMALLENDIAN
+#define H(x) ((SHORT)((((SHORT)(x))&0xFF)<<8)+(((USHORT)(x))>>8))
+#define UH(x) ((USHORT)((((USHORT)(x))&0xFF)<<8)+(((USHORT)(x))>>8))
+#define L(x) ((LONG)(((LONG)UH((x)&0xFFFF))<<16)+UH(((ULONG)(x))>>16))
+#define UL(x) ((ULONG)(((ULONG)UH((x)&0xFFFF))<<16)+UH(((ULONG)(x))>>16))
+#else
+#define H(x) ((SHORT)x)
+#define UH(x) ((USHORT)x)
+#define L(x) ((LONG)x)
+#define UL(x) ((ULONG)x)
+#endif
+
+#define FIX_H(x) x=H(x)
+#define FIX_UH(x) x=UH(x)
+#define FIX_L(x) x=L(x)
+#define FIX_UL(x) x=UL(x)
+
+/* We are assuming that the compiler will not pad the following
+ * structures; note that their members are intrinsically properly
+ * aligned. This will probably break on some machines. */
+
+typedef struct
+{
+ SHORT mantissa;
+ USHORT fraction;
+} Fixed;
+
+#define FIX_Fixed(x) {(x).mantissa=H((x).mantissa); (x).fraction=UH((x).fraction);}
+
+typedef struct
+{
+ BYTE data[8];
+} longDateTime;
+
+typedef USHORT uFWord;
+typedef SHORT FWord;
+typedef USHORT F2Dot14;
+
+#define MAKE_ULONG(a,b,c,d) ((ULONG)(((ULONG)(a)<<24)|((b)<<16)|((c)<<8)|(d)))
+
